Attributed Translations

open access: yesJournal of Computer and System Sciences, 1974
Attributed translation grammars are introduced as a means of specifying a translation from strings of input symbols to strings of output symbols. Each of these symbols can have a finite set of attributes, each of which can take on a value from a possibly infinite set.

Attribute-Based Encryption for Range Attributes

open access: yesIEICE Transactions on Fundamentals of Electronics, Communications and Computer Sciences, 2016
Attribute-Based Encryption ABE is an advanced form of public-key encryption where access control mechanisms based on attributes and policies are possible.
